COUNTRY MUSIC STAR KELSEA BALLERINI AND ACTOR ANTHONY MACKIE TO HOST THE "2022 CMT MUSIC AWARDS," MONDAY, APRIL 11 ON CBS

Country Music's Only Entirely Fan-Voted Awards Show to Air LIVE from Nashville

2022 Nominations to be Announced Wednesday, March 16

"CMT Music Awards Extended Cut" to Air Friday, April 15 with All-New Performances and Bonus Content on CMT

CBS and CMT announced today that country music star Kelsea Ballerini and actor Anthony Mackie will take the stage as co-hosts of the 2022 CMT MUSIC AWARDS, country music's only entirely fan-voted awards show, broadcasting LIVE on Monday, April 11 (8:00-11:00 PM LIVE ET/delayed PT) from Nashville's historic Municipal Auditorium, and various locations in and around Nashville. This will be the inaugural broadcast of the CMT MUSIC AWARDS on the CBS Television Network, as Paramount's signature country music tentpole celebrates the hottest stars with high-powered, cross-genre performances from in and around Music City. The show will also be available to stream live and on demand on Paramount+*.

This marks Mackie's first time as host, after he presented the highly coveted Video of the Year award last year. Ballerini returns to host for the second consecutive year. Nominations for the 2022 CMT MUSIC AWARDS will be announced on Wednesday, March 16, in tandem with the start of fan voting at vote.cmt.com. Additional details about nominations, performers and presenters will be announced in the coming weeks.

About the CMT MUSIC AWARDS

Celebrated for its high-powered, world-premiere and cross-genre performances, the CMT MUSIC AWARDS have aired live since 2005, delivering Nashville's biggest party to music fans across the globe. The 2021 show, hosted by superstars Kelsea Ballerini and Kane Brown, featured the most first-time collaborations and blended-genre pairings in show history. Standout performances included H.E.R. + Chris Stapleton, Gladys Knight, Mickey Guyton + BRELAND, and NEEDTOBREATHE + Carrie Underwood, who remains the most-awarded artist in CMT Awards history with 23 wins.
